Overview
Programmable Logic Controllers (PLCs) are specialized industrial computers designed for controlling manufacturing processes and machinery. They were first developed in the late 1960s to replace hard-wired relay systems in automotive plants. Today, PLCs form the backbone of industrial automation across various sectors. Modern PLCs consist of a central processing unit (CPU), input/output (I/O) modules, power supply, and communication interfaces. They execute control programs stored in non-volatile memory to monitor inputs and control outputs in real-time, making them essential for reliable automation solutions.
Structure and Working Principle
The basic structure of a PLC includes a processor (CPU), memory, input/output interfaces, power supply, and communication modules. The CPU executes the control program stored in memory, which typically follows a scan cycle of input reading, program execution, and output updating. PLCs operate on a cyclic scan principle where they continuously check input statuses, execute the control logic, and update outputs accordingly. This deterministic operation makes them ideal for real-time control applications. The modular design allows customization with various I/O modules for digital, analog, temperature, motion, and other specialized functions.
Key Features
PLCs offer several distinctive features that make them indispensable in industrial automation. Their rugged construction allows operation in harsh industrial environments with wide temperature ranges, vibration, and electrical noise. Most PLCs support multiple communication protocols like Ethernet/IP, Modbus, and Profibus for network integration. Advanced PLCs now incorporate features like motion control, PID loops, data logging, and web server capabilities. They provide deterministic operation with scan times typically in milliseconds, ensuring precise control of fast processes. Many models support remote monitoring and programming for easier maintenance and troubleshooting.
Application Areas
PLCs are widely used across numerous industries due to their reliability and flexibility. In manufacturing, they control assembly lines, robotic cells, and packaging machines. Process industries utilize PLCs for batch control, mixing operations, and quality monitoring in food, pharmaceutical, and chemical plants. Other applications include building automation (HVAC control, lighting systems), infrastructure (water treatment, traffic signals), and energy management (power generation, distribution). The automotive industry was an early adopter and remains one of the largest users of PLC technology for production line automation.
Maintenance and Precautions
Proper maintenance ensures long-term reliability of PLC systems. Regular checks should include verifying power supply voltages, inspecting connections for corrosion or looseness, and cleaning ventilation filters. Backup batteries for memory retention should be replaced periodically according to manufacturer specifications. When working with PLCs, precautions include proper grounding to prevent electrical noise interference, protection from excessive vibration, and maintaining clean power supplies. Environmental considerations include operating within specified temperature and humidity ranges, and protecting from excessive dust or moisture where required by the application environment.
B2B Procurement Guide
When procuring PLCs for industrial applications, consider several key factors. Determine the required number and type of I/O points (digital, analog, specialty) with some capacity for future expansion. Evaluate the processor speed and memory capacity needed for your control algorithms and data handling requirements. Compatibility with existing systems is crucial - consider communication protocols, programming software, and integration with SCADA or HMI systems. For harsh environments, verify the IP rating and operating temperature range. Lead times for specialized PLCs can vary, so plan procurement accordingly. Prices typically range from $500 for basic units to $10,000+ for high-performance models with extensive I/O capabilities.
